JOB DESCRIPTION:

  • Oversee the financial activities of the Company for financial reporting and help management make financial decisions. You will interface with managers of other departments, implement Group company policies and respond to questions and issues concerning Finance and Accounting matters.
  • Responsible to prepare, analyze, and report financial performance against key business metrics. Prepare budget and regular forecast in conjunction with the requirements of the Head office
  • You will evaluate the processed accounting information in the system to appraise operating results in terms of profitability, performance against budget and operating effectiveness of the organization.
  • You are responsible to oversee month-end closing process. Ensure transactions for the moths are completely captured and recorded in the books. Accounts for revenue and costs/expenses that needs to be accrued. Ensure prepayment amortization and FA depreciation are properly recorded.
  • Manage cash flow and forecasting. Ensure that billing and collection schedules are adhered to and vendor terms are maximized to support operation requirements.
  • Maintain banking relationships.
  • You will lead and ensure compliance with statutory annual audit process and tax reporting. Liaise with auditors and tax consultants.
  • Supervise team members who do the billings, payments, revenue reconciliations and analysis of GL accounts. Monitor financial details to ensure that legal requirements are met.
